Description Luca Pizzamiglio 2013-02-06 15:55:05 UTC
When I build Amarok on i386 I get a compile error:
/usr/ports/audio/amarok-kde4/work/amarok-2.7.0/src/playlistgenerator/constraints/PlaylistFileSize.cpp:175:
error: integer constant is too large for 'long' type

A 64bit integer number is used without the LL suffix

I cannot explain here all related question about what you've written, but:
* FreeBSD 8 & 9 has, as default compiler, gcc 4.2.1 because newer gcc adopts GPLv3, incompatible with the BSD license.
* FreeBSD 9 and Current (10) is moving to another compiler, clang. No problem raised with it.
* The change I'm proposing is covered by the C99 standard, so perfectly compliant with almost every new compilers. It's a minimal modification, just add the ULL or LL suffix to a number, to specify that it's a 64 bit integer. In my personal opinion, it improves readability and compatibility.
* we use, when we find a problem, to propose a patch to be integrated in the mainline, when this patch contributes to compatibility without damage the original source code (that's the case)
